Episode 181 / Contemporary romance author Catharina Maura shares how she combined her favorite trope, marriage of convenience, with lessons she learned writing her early books to create a best-selling series.We also delve into why marketing is an extension of storytelling, why you don’t have to do everything yourself, and how to keep readers thinking about your books and talking about them, using bonus material and a drip campaign.Catharina Maura’s website: https://catharinamaura.com/https://www.instagram.com/catharinamaura/? ? Welcome to the Wish I'd Known Then podcast. Join authors Jami Albright and Sara Rosett as they interview self published authors about how they found success as well as what they've learned from their missteps. Because being an indie author is about being innovative and creative and learning from your mistakes.
